Unlike major tourist attractions in Athens, skip-the-line options are typically not required for attractions in Preveza, like Ancient Nicopolis or its museum. Visitor numbers generally remain lower, so tickets are usually purchased directly at the entrance without long waits.
Ancient Nicopolis: Visit early morning (around 8:00 AM in summer) or late afternoon. This helps to avoid intense midday heat and the busiest periods. Preveza Waterfront: distinguished for pleasant, lively goings-on in the late afternoon and evening. Beaches: Head earlier in the early part of the day for extra space and calmer waters before crowds arrive.
Taxis: For quick transit between attractions, taxis are the fastest way, especially without a rental car. Rental Car: HAVING a rental car allows for the most flexibility and time for excursions to Lefkada, Parga, or the Acheron River, without bus schedules dictating movement.
